Fully integrated charger with FET pass transistor,
reverse-blocking diode, sense resistor and thermal
protection
K
High Accuracy Charge Current*
K
Tiny 3mm x 3mm 10 lead MLP package
K
Programmable precharge, fastcharge & termination
current
K
Battery voltage controlled to 1% accuracy
K
Built in timer for protection and complete charging
K
NTC interface with battery detection
K
Soft-start for step load and adaptor plug-in
K
Up to 1A continuous charge current
K
Input voltage range from 3V to 6V allows seamless
charging from current limited adapter
K
Provides buffered adapter voltage VCCIL to power
external accessories
K
Battery Present detection and output indicator
K
Operates in charger or LDO-mode without battery
K
0.1
A battery drain current in shutdown and
monitor modes
K
Over current protection in all charging modes
K
CHRGB output communicates charging and end of
charge cycle

The SC805 is a fully integrated, single cell, constant-cur-
rent (cc)/constant-voltage (cv) Lithium-Ion battery charger
in a tiny 3x3 mm thermally enhanced lead free MLP pack-
age. The SC805 can operate as a stand-alone charger or
in conjunction with a Power Management Controller
(PMIC).
The SC805 has a pre-charge function for trickle charging
deeply discharged batteries. The fast charge current is
enabled automatically when the battery voltage reaches
the required threshold. When the battery reaches the
constant voltage or CV portion of the charge curve the
SC805 switches to CV regulation mode. In this mode
the output current decays until the termination current is
reached. At this point the SC805 signals the charge cycle
is complete. The charger can be configured to continue
charging for a predetermined time or turn off when the
termination current is reached. After the charger turns
off the output device, the SC805 enters monitor mode.
If the battery voltage drops by 100mV from the CV volt-
age a new charge cycle will begin. The timer function
also protects against charging faulty batteries by turning
off if the pre-charge time exceeds 1/4 of the total pro-
grammed charge duration.
The SC805 also provides battery detection, NTC inter-
face, and a buffered output for driving system loads from
the adapter input supply.
The SC805 can also function as a general purpose cur-
rent source or as a current source for charging nickel-
cadmium (NiCd) and nickel-metal-hydride (NiMH) batter-
ies.
